Taking to Instagram on Sunday, October 27, 2024, Wofa Fada shared photos showing herself in a short white gown, holding a bouquet, next to Taiwo Cole, who was dressed in a blue suit.
She captioned the photo, “Every love story is beautiful, but ours is my favourite. #Twoforever #MrsCole. 2 of 3, and forever to go.”
Her second post featured a video from the Ikoyi marriage registry, capturing several intimate moments between the couple.
Wofai thanked everyone for their support, saying, “Thank you guys for all the love and congratulatory messages.
“As you continue to share in our joy and happiness, may you always be congratulated. My online family, y’all are the best.”
This civil wedding came after their traditional ceremony in May in Wofa’s hometown, Ugep, Cross River State.
Wofai Fada had faced backlash from her in-laws, who publicly opposed their marriage.
Taiwo Cole’s family even released a statement claiming they were unaware of the union.
Unconfirmed reports suggest that Cole’s father objected to the marriage due to the age difference between the couple.
KanyiDaily recalls that Wofai Fada, whose real name is Wofai Egu Ewa, announced her engagement on social media in May.
